N.Z. TOUR DEFERRED
AUSTRALIAN CRICKETERS EFFECT OF THE WAR (Per Press Association.) CHRISTCHURCH, this day. Following discussions between the Australian Board of Control and the New Zealand Cricket Council, and after considering the difficulties arising from Ihe war, it has been jointly decided that the proposed New Zealand tour by the Australian team be abandoned for the time being. A statement issued by the management 1 committee says it is naturally with great regret that the committee found itself forced by the existing circumstances to this decision.
